Transaction 5295424d88b460e7c8bab87ee1237cf21cbd947214037199293fea8d8ff5f735
2 Input
2 Outputs
- 5295424d88b460e7c8bab87ee1237cf21cbd947214037199293fea8d8ff5f735:0
- 5295424d88b460e7c8bab87ee1237cf21cbd947214037199293fea8d8ff5f735:1
value 473312962
address 1HZMc9aEuEBAtVfJc3xXdwdMx4TymF6Y96
value 27715765
address 1FXB5bxH4J8HnQC1eEWchomhnuiYStS6BN